Choosing the Right Ice Cream for Your Shakes
Choosing the Right Ice Cream: A Key to Guilt-Free Bliss
When it comes to creating a guilt-free indulgence, one critical factor stands out – selecting an ideal ice cream flavor. The type of ice cream can make all the difference in crafting a creamy treat that’s as delicious as it is refreshing.
Here are some tips to help you choose the perfect ice cream for your next milkshake adventure:
- Dense Ice Cream Delights
Classic flavors like vanilla and chocolate work wonders when paired with fruit-based milks. The denser texture of these ice creams holds their own against tart fruits, making them a great choice for summer desserts.
For example, try combining rich vanilla bean ice cream with strawberries or raspberries to create a refreshing twist on the classic milkshake. The creamy texture and deep flavor of dense ice cream balance out the sweetness of fresh fruit, resulting in a delightful treat that’s sure to satisfy your sweet tooth.
However, be aware that thicker ice creams can make milkshakes too thick to drink. To avoid this common mistake, consider blending in some lighter textures like crushed nuts or chocolate chips. This will not only add crunch but also help distribute the flavors evenly throughout the drink.
- Lighter Ice Creams: The Perfect Companion
When it comes to creating a fruity flavor profile, light ice creams are your best bet. Flavors like pistachio and honey vanilla work beautifully with fresh fruits, adding a refreshing twist to classic milkshakes.
For instance, try pairing lighter mint chip ice cream with peaches or pineapple for a sweet and tangy treat that’s perfect for warm weather. The subtle flavor of light ice creams won’t overpower the natural taste of the fruit, creating a balanced drink that’s both refreshing and delicious.
When working with lighter ice creams, remember to balance out your flavors by adding complementary ingredients like citrus zest or nutty flavorings. This will not only enhance the overall taste but also add depth and complexity to your milkshake creations.

Coffee is a popular choice for adding depth and richness to milkshake flavors. For example, try pairing espresso with vanilla ice cream, cocoa powder, and chocolate chips in a creamy treat that’s sure to satisfy your caffeine fix. If you want something more exotic, mix strong brewed coffee with hazelnut syrup and crushed nuts for a mocha-flavored delight.
For those looking for an English breakfast-style shake, use Earl Grey tea as the base and combine it with raspberry sorbet, lemon zest, and a hint of honey for a refreshing twist on classic flavors. Alternatively, create a creamy matcha milkshake that’s packed with antioxidants by blending Japanese green tea with coconut milk and white chocolate chips.
